| Aspect | Per Diem Remote Listener | Per Diem Medical Transcriptionist |
|---|
| Credentials | Listening skills, basic computer proficiency | Medical transcription certification, typing skills |
| Work Environment | Remote, flexible hours | Remote, often with specific turnaround times |
| Industry Usage | Healthcare, mental health, counseling | Healthcare, medical documentation |
| Search & Comparison Intent | Job duties, remote listening roles | Transcription tasks, medical documentation jobs |
Per Diem Remote Listeners primarily focus on listening to audio recordings in healthcare or counseling settings, requiring strong listening skills and basic tech knowledge. In contrast, Per Diem Medical Transcriptionists transcribe medical audio into written reports, often needing certification and typing proficiency. Both roles are remote and flexible but serve different functions within the healthcare industry.
